Q. Should “tea party” be capitalized? I cannot find it referenced in CMOS, but I’ve noticed that AP news stories lowercase “tea party,” “tea partiers,” and so forth.
A. Initially, we too lowercased phrases denoting that movement and its proponents. But because the term “Tea Party” is modeled on names for established parties, we now apply initial caps, in line with Merriam-Webster’s entry for “tea party,” sense 3. See CMOS 8.68.
